Discovery through support

Testing runs inside the build loop rather than after it.

  1. 01

    Discovery

    1 to 3 weeks

    We map the problem before we price the solution: stakeholder interviews, review of current systems, technical constraints, and the success measures we will be held to. You get a requirements document, a proposed architecture, a delivery plan and a fixed price or a rate card with a confident range. Paid, and creditable against the build if you proceed.

  2. 02

    Design

    2 to 4 weeks

    User flows, wireframes, then high-fidelity screens and a component library. Your team reviews clickable prototypes before engineering starts, because changing a prototype costs an afternoon and changing a built feature costs a sprint.

  3. 03

    Build

    Two-week sprints

    Sprint planning on Monday, demo on the second Friday, and a staging environment you can use at any point in between. You get a named delivery lead, direct access to engineers on your own Slack or Teams channel, and a burndown you can check without asking.

  4. 04

    Test

    Continuous

    Automated unit and integration tests in the pipeline; manual QA against acceptance criteria each sprint; performance and security testing before launch; a user acceptance window with your team. Nothing ships on a green pipeline alone.

  5. 05

    Launch

    Staged

    A deployment runbook with a rehearsed rollback, phased or canary release where the risk warrants it, monitoring and alerting live before traffic, and a support window with heightened response for the first two weeks.

  6. 06

    Support

    Ongoing

    An agreed response commitment, proactive monitoring, dependency and security patching, and a quarterly review of what to improve next. Your team gets documentation and a handover session; the aim is that you could run it without us.

Deliberately boring about the stack

We choose technology on three tests: can it carry the load you will have in three years, can your team hire for it, and can we hand it over cleanly. That last one rules out more clever options than the first two combined. Every system we build ships with documentation, tests and a handover session — because the measure of a good engagement is that you do not need us for it afterwards.
